Understanding the Role of a Federal Regulatory Affairs Specialist

A Federal Regulatory Affairs Specialist is responsible for managing compliance with federal laws and regulations across different industries. Their main job is to interpret complex legal requirements and ensure that organizations follow them correctly. They work closely with legal teams, government agencies, and internal departments to maintain compliance standards.

This role involves reviewing policies, preparing reports, and communicating regulatory updates. Specialists must stay informed about changes in laws and ensure that their organizations adapt quickly. Their work helps companies operate legally and maintain a good reputation.

Key Responsibilities of the Role

A Federal Regulatory Affairs Specialist handles several important tasks. One of their main responsibilities is to monitor and analyze federal regulations that impact their industry. They study new laws and assess how they affect business operations.

They also develop compliance strategies and implement internal policies. This includes training employees on regulatory requirements and ensuring that all processes meet legal standards. Documentation is another key responsibility, as specialists must maintain accurate records for audits and inspections.

Communication plays a major role in this position. Specialists act as a point of contact between organizations and regulatory authorities. They ensure that all information is shared clearly and correctly.

Regulatory Frameworks and Agencies

Federal regulations in the United States are managed by various government agencies. Each agency focuses on specific industries and areas. For example, the Food and Drug Administration oversees healthcare products, while the Environmental Protection Agency manages environmental regulations.

A Federal Regulatory Affairs Specialist must understand how these agencies operate and what rules they enforce. This knowledge helps them ensure that their organization meets all necessary requirements.

Understanding regulatory frameworks is also important for long-term planning. It allows specialists to prepare for changes and keep their organization ahead of compliance challenges.

Strategies for Effective Compliance Management

Effective compliance management requires a structured approach. One key strategy is to develop clear policies and procedures that align with federal regulations. These policies should be easy to understand and follow.

Regular training is another important strategy. Employees must be aware of compliance requirements and understand their role in maintaining them. This helps reduce errors and ensures consistent adherence to regulations.

Monitoring and auditing are also essential. By regularly reviewing processes, specialists can identify potential issues and address them before they become serious problems. This proactive approach helps maintain compliance at all times.

Challenges in Regulatory Affairs

Working in regulatory affairs comes with several challenges. One of the biggest challenges is keeping up with constantly changing regulations. Laws and policies are updated frequently, and specialists must stay informed at all times.

Another challenge is managing complex documentation. Regulatory requirements often involve detailed records and reports, which can be time-consuming to maintain. Specialists must ensure that all documentation is accurate and up to date.

Balancing compliance with business goals can also be difficult. Organizations want to grow and innovate, but they must do so within legal boundaries. A Federal Regulatory Affairs Specialist helps find the right balance between these objectives.

Career Opportunities and Future Scope

The demand for Federal Regulatory Affairs Specialists is increasing as regulations become more complex. Many industries require skilled professionals to manage compliance and ensure legal operations.

Career opportunities are available in government agencies, private companies, and consulting firms. Professionals in this field can specialize in areas such as healthcare, finance, or environmental regulation.

With experience, specialists can move into senior roles such as regulatory managers or compliance directors. Continuous learning and professional development are important for career growth in this field.

The future of regulatory affairs looks promising, with increasing focus on compliance, risk management, and global standards. This makes it a stable and rewarding career choice for individuals interested in law, business, and public policy.
